If anybody is still wondering about the logic here (although I think we're all beyond it now), I think I've got it figured out. When I'm perplexed, I always like to think in extremes:
Case 1) One day I might want to turbo my 944NA (really!!). I'd want 350hp to the wheels, and I'd want someone to pretty much guarantee it. I'd pay $10-20k or more for a reliable job. I'd do the research and then get it done, maybe by JME or Powerhaus. I would not do a "before dyno test". It would make no sense. Would anyone disagree with that? (Right now, I might be making 130hp at the wheels. Who cares if its 125 or 135?)
Case2) Hypothetically, a local "tuner" suggests that I drill holes in the airbox of my 964. Not knowing any better (hypothetically, remember), I ask about the performance gain that I could expect. He guarantees me 6hp or double my money back, plus free removal of my engine undertray. How could either of us verify the result if we don't do a before dyno run? With drivetrain loss, a 15 year old car, etc - it would be impossible to judge the outcome. I think that everyone would agree on that point.
so - Adrian may be thinking along the lines of case #1, and the rest of the mouths on the board are thinking more along the lines of case #2. IMHO, if Adrian wants to think of his job like case #1, he has every right to. Nobody should badger him - and after reading all of these posts, I can't think of a better term to describe the treatment to our favorite (and stubborn - like alot of us including me) 964 guru.
